🚨 #ICYMI: The state announced an updated #COVID19 vaccine eligibility timeline:
✅ March 22: Residents 60+ AND certain workers
✅ April 5: Residents 55+ AND residents with one certain medical condition
✅ April 19: General public age 16 and older
